We have a great opportunity for an experienced Audit Professional to join our team as an

Audit Team Manager . You will be responsible for managing a team of Auditors within the UK and Ireland to deliver a high-quality, cost-effective audit service that delivers real value to our customers. Your experience will enable you to promote audits and advisory visits to potential clients and advise internal and external stakeholders on Achilles audit services. Able to work autonomously and coordinate a number of activities at a time, you’ll need strong people skills and a quality focus to ensure the team delivers a service that retains and grows our customer base. This role is home-based. There will be requirements to regularly travel to client sites in the UK and occasionally overseas, and to our Head Office in Abingdon, Oxfordshire. Responsibilities:

Support and manage a team of remote auditors spread across the UK and Ireland. Contribute to the ongoing development of the various Achilles audit programmes and provide constructive feedback to ensure the ongoing development of the schemes. Continually monitor industry trends to ensure our audit programmes continue to meet both the company’s and the client’s needs. Deliver audits to specified levels of quality, time and cost that meet the requirements of the relevant industry and scheme standards. Provide technical sales support and presentations to new and existing customers. We seek candidates with a curious mindset who will represent our organisation with professionalism, dedication, and a commitment to operational excellence. You should be able to communicate clearly to different audiences, work collaboratively across teams, and proactively input into bringing business value to our customers. You will have experience managing and developing team members to maximise their potential. For more than 30 years, Achilles has protected organisations’ business interests and reputations by providing unrivalled levels of supply chain transparency, carbon reduction, and management. We are the ESG and carbon management partner of choice for the world’s leading global brands. Achilles specialises in supporting customers that require truly robust environmental, social, and governance reporting to fully comply with ESG regulation, meet investor requirements, and achieve their own ambitious sustainability goals. We work with market-leading financial, industrial, commercial, and governmental organisations requiring the serious, detailed analysis and expert insight necessary to deliver exceptional reporting confidence. Operating from 17 locations worldwide, Achilles is at the forefront of the battle against climate change, a champion for social justice and human rights, and an expert in health, safety, and risk management.
